Google Chrome: Home and Bookmarks buttons

Many users, using Google Chrome, have noticed that it has no Home and Bookmarks button.




For bookmarks it has bookmark bar, but it's not good if you have too many bookmarks to manage. How can you get those buttons.

Getting home button is very easy. Just go to chrome settings: Click "Option" under

















Just check "Show Home button on the toolbar" and you are done.
To see specific page as home page instead of your recent sites thumbnails, select open this page, and enter whichever page you like to see.

To add bookmark button you have to use command switch of chome --bookmark-menu.
It will get your bookmark button when you open chrome next time.

(i.e.) "C:\Documents and Settings\Administrator\Local Settings\Application Data\Google\Chrome\Application\chrome.exe" --bookmark-menu

If you don't know how to do this, then you can alternatively do the following.
Close all open chrome instances.
Right click chrome shortcut, and go to property.
In target, just append  --bookmark-menu
Now when you open chrome, you'll get bookmark button.
